Feeling a bit down as I’ve got half way to my goal and now I feel as though my weight loss has slowed down. I also feel like when I look in the mirror i can barely see any change and still see the fat girl who made the decision to change her lifestyle.

I thought when I got to this point I’d be proud and happier with my body but all I can think about is how long it will be until I reach my goal.

Morning FGS0131

Sorry to hear you're feeling down today, you should be so proud of yourself for losing 1st 7lbs so far.:)

I know it can be dishearting when the scales slow down, but look at what you have achieved! Have you measured yourself, as seeing the inches go down can be a great motivator to keep you going.

When I slow down I relook over the last few weeks to see if the calories are slowly creeping up or if I've not done enough exercise. Then I adjust it to get back on track.

Have you tried joining the Daily Diary for a week or so, for some extra support and to pick up some extra tips?

Shake up the calories. Eat more than normal for a day or two. If you eat the same number day after day, your body can adapt. Go for 1500. You’ll be surprised.

James40Cheshire profile image
James40Cheshire

I agree that a maintenance break would be a good idea. You have been cutting very hard on 1100 and your body is fighting back. Try eating towards the high end of your calorie range for a week and then reduce towards the lower end, but don't go lower. This should allow your body to reset and kick start weight loss again. Personally I don't have to program maintenance breaks because my social life and weak will power ensure they happen! Good luck with it. James
